Ingredients
For the Chicken Tenders
- 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 8 strips bacon
- ½ cup brown sugar
- ½ teaspoon kosher salt
- ⅛ teaspoon ground black pepper
For Garnish
- 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, finely chopped

How to Make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) to prepare for baking.
Step 2: Prepare Chicken
Slice each chicken breast into 4 long, thin strips. You should have a total of 8 tenders.
Step 3: Season & Coat
In a mixing bowl, combine the brown sugar, kosher salt, and black pepper. Toss the chicken strips in this mixture until they are well coated.
Step 4: Wrap in Bacon
Wrap each chicken tender with one strip of bacon. Arrange them neatly in a baking dish or place them on a foil-lined baking sheet.
Step 5: Top with Sugar
Sprinkle any remaining brown sugar mixture over the wrapped chicken tenders to enhance their sweetness.
Step 6: Bake
Bake in the preheated oven for 20–25 minutes. Ensure that the bacon is crispy and the chicken is fully cooked. For extra crispiness, broil for an additional 1–2 minutes at the end—keeping a close eye on it!
Step 7: Serve Hot
Serve your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ders hot from the oven. They make an excellent appetizer or can be enjoyed over salad, rice, or even waffles for a unique twist!

How to Perfect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ders
Achieving perfection with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ders is easy with a few tips. Follow these suggestions to ensure your tenders turn out delicious every time.
- Use thick-cut bacon: Thicker bacon provides more flavor and ensures it crisps up nicely around the chicken.
- Pat chicken dry: Before seasoning, make sure to pat the chicken strips dry. This helps the brown sugar adhere better.
- Don’t overcrowd the baking dish: Give each tender space in the dish to ensure even cooking and crispiness.
- Monitor cooking time: Keep an eye on your chicken tenders while baking. Ovens can vary, so adjust cooking time as needed for perfect results.
- Let rest before serving: Allow the chicken tenders to rest for a few minutes after baking. This helps the juices redistribute for tender meat.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
When making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ders, avoid these common mistakes to ensure they turn out perfectly.
- Skipping the seasoning: Failing to coat the chicken strips well can result in bland tenders. Make sure to toss them thoroughly in the brown sugar mixture before wrapping.
- Using thick bacon: Thick cut bacon may not cook properly with the tender chicken. Opt for regular or thin-cut bacon for even cooking and crispy results.
- Overcrowding the baking dish: Placing too many tenders too close together can lead to steaming instead of crisping. Leave some space between each tender on the baking sheet.
- Not monitoring cooking time: Baking times can vary based on your oven and thickness of bacon. Check for doneness and crispiness, especially during the last few minutes.
- Neglecting to let them rest: Cutting into the chicken right after baking can release juices, resulting in dry tenders. Allow them to rest for a few minutes before serving.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
- Ensure they are completely cooled before sealing to prevent condensation.
Freezing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ders
- Freeze in a single layer on a baking sheet before transferring to a freezer-safe bag or container.
- They can be frozen for up to 2 months.
Reheating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and bake for about 10–15 minutes until heated through.
- Microwave: Heat on medium power in short intervals (30 seconds) until warm but avoid overheating, which can make them rubbery.
- Stovetop: Heat in a skillet over medium heat, turning occasionally until warmed through.

Frequently Asked Questions
Here are some frequently asked questions about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ders.
Can I use other meats for this recipe?
You can certainly try other meats like pork tenderloin or turkey! Adjust cooking times as needed.
What sides go well with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ders?
These tenders pair beautifully with salads, rice, or even sweet potato fries for a balanced meal.
How do I make Bacon Brown Sugar Chicken Tenders healthier?
Consider using turkey bacon and reducing the brown sugar quantity to lower calories without compromising flavor.
Can I prepare these tenders ahead of time?
Yes! You can assemble them and store them in the fridge until you’re ready to bake, making them perfect for entertaining.
